What are Cybersecurity Courses?

Cybersecurity courses are specialized programs designed to teach individuals how to protect computer systems, networks, and data from cyber attacks. These courses encompass a broad spectrum of topics, such as:

  1. Network Security: Learning how to secure networks from unauthorized access, attacks, and misuse.
  2. Ethical Hacking: Understanding how to identify and exploit vulnerabilities in systems to improve their security.
  3. Cryptography: The study of techniques for secure communication in the presence of adversaries.
  4. Digital Forensics: Investigating cyber incidents to understand the nature and scope of the attack.
  5. Incident Response: Developing strategies to respond effectively to cybersecurity incidents.

The Different Types of Cybersecurity

  1. Network Security

Network security involves protecting the integrity, confidentiality, and availability of data as it is transmitted across or within a network. This includes implementing firewalls, intrusion detection systems, and secure VPNs. Students learn to design and manage secure network architectures, ensuring that data flows safely between systems.

  1. Information Security

Information security focuses on safeguarding data from unauthorized access and tampering. Techniques include encryption, access controls, and the development of security policies. Students are trained to protect data in storage and during transmission, ensuring its confidentiality and integrity.

  1. Application Security

Application security addresses vulnerabilities within software applications. This includes practices like secure coding, application testing, and patch management. Courses teach students how to identify and mitigate security flaws throughout the software development lifecycle, from design to deployment.

  1. Operational Security (OPSEC)

Operational security involves processes and practices that protect sensitive information from being accessed by adversaries. It includes risk management, asset management, and incident response planning. Students learn to develop comprehensive security strategies that safeguard an organization’s operations.

  1. Cloud Security

With the rapid adoption of cloud services, cloud security has become crucial. It focuses on protecting data and applications hosted in cloud environments. This includes securing cloud infrastructure, managing access controls, and ensuring compliance with industry standards. Courses in cloud security teach students how to navigate the complexities of securing cloud-based systems.

  1. Identity and Access Management (IAM)

IAM is critical for managing user identities and controlling access to resources. It encompasses practices like authentication, authorization, and accounting. Students learn to design and implement IAM solutions that ensure only authorized users have access to specific data and systems.

Why is Cybersecurity Important?

  1. Protecting Sensitive Data

In a digital age where vast amounts of personal, financial, and business data are generated daily, protecting this information from cyber threats is vital. Cybersecurity measures prevent unauthorized access, data breaches, and identity theft, safeguarding both individual privacy and corporate assets.

  1. Maintaining Privacy

As more personal information is shared online, privacy concerns have grown. Cybersecurity ensures that personal data remains confidential and is only accessible to authorized users, thereby protecting individuals’ privacy rights.

  1. Preventing Financial Losses

Cyber attacks can result in significant financial losses for businesses and individuals. Ransomware, phishing scams, and other cyber threats can lead to direct financial damage and costly downtime. Effective cybersecurity strategies mitigate these risks, ensuring financial stability.

  1. Ensuring Business Continuity

Businesses rely heavily on their IT infrastructure for day-to-day operations. A robust cybersecurity framework ensures that business activities continue without interruption in the event of a cyber incident. This includes implementing disaster recovery plans and maintaining backup systems.

  1. Compliance with Regulations

Many industries are governed by stringent data protection regulations, such as GDPR, HIPAA, and PCI-DSS. Cybersecurity ensures that organizations comply with these laws, avoiding hefty fines and legal repercussions.
